Alice Brown Chittenden, American 1859-1944- Study of wildflowers with forget-me-nots; oil on paper, signed and dated 'A.B. Chittenden. 93' (lower right), 42.4 x 30 cm. Provenance: Private Collection, UK. Note: Chittenden was a prominent and versatile artist who worked in her home town of San Francisco. She was particularly celebrated for her botanical works, producing, over the course of 50 years, 256 paintings of 350 varieties of Californian wildflowers. Chittenden's works exhibit a striking accuracy, with their scientific significance surely enhanced by the assistance she received from her friend Alice Eastwood (1859-1953), a curator of botany at the California Academy of Sciences in San Francisco.
